Sorry, there was a problem. Please try again later.The instructions left out one step. After you enter the code you press the source button till all the buttons light up. Then you enter the code again. Then you press the volume + then exit. I was going crazy trying to program the remote until I checked out a how to video on YouTube. The instructions omitted the volume+ step.
